300pid規(guī)格化問題
林慧玲
發(fā)布于2014-03-28 18:01
361
0
標(biāo)簽:
300pid里fb41里面參數(shù)規(guī)格化問題有關(guān)設(shè)定值問題,現(xiàn)在直接用外設(shè)i/o格式的,也就是說pvper_on一直為on,然后pv_per直接填iw,輸出lmn_per直接填qw,現(xiàn)在問題是sp_int設(shè)定值的問題,比如說輸入變量量程是0-10mpa,現(xiàn)在想設(shè)定5mpa,那么sp_int是否填入的數(shù)據(jù)時(shí)5/10后再乘以27648,也就是13824即可?看看,
佳答案
在pid調(diào)節(jié)中有不同的物理量,因此在參數(shù)設(shè)定中需將其規(guī)格化:
1.規(guī)格化概念及方法:
pid參數(shù)中重要的幾個(gè)變量,給定值,反饋值和輸出值都是用0.0~1.0之間的實(shí)數(shù)表示,
而這幾個(gè)變量在實(shí)際中都是來自與模擬輸入,或者輸出控制模擬量的
因此,需要將模擬輸入轉(zhuǎn)換為0.0~1.0的數(shù)據(jù),或?qū)?.0~1.0的數(shù)據(jù)轉(zhuǎn)換為模擬輸出,這個(gè)過程稱為規(guī)格化
規(guī)格化的方法:(即變量相對所占整個(gè)值域范圍內(nèi)的百分比對應(yīng)與27648數(shù)字量范圍內(nèi)的量)
對于輸入和反饋,執(zhí)行:變量*100/27648,然后將結(jié)果傳送到pv-in和sp-int
對于輸出變量,執(zhí)行:lmn*27648/100,然后將結(jié)果取整傳送給pqw即可;
2.例:
輸入?yún)?shù):
sp_int(給定值):0--100%的實(shí)數(shù)。
假定模塊的輸入變量量程為0-10mpa,則sp_in的范圍0.0-1.00對應(yīng)0-10mpa.可以根據(jù)這一比例關(guān)系來設(shè)置給定值。例:如給定5.0mpa
sp_int(給定值)=5.0/(10.0-0.0)*100.0=50.0(50%)